Description

The Dangerous Music MASTER Mastering Transfer Console is your secret weapon for achieving unparalleled sonic precision in your studio. Designed for those who demand the highest fidelity and control, this console brings the legendary Dangerous Music sound into the realm of mastering with a unique approach that sets it apart from the rest. Audiophile-grade components ensure that every nuance of your mix is preserved with crystal-clear clarity.

At the heart of the MASTER is its innovative S&M (Sum and Minus) functionality, which offers integrated Mid-Side processing capabilities. This feature allows you to fine-tune the stereo spread of your mix, giving you the ability to enhance the width without compromising the center material. Imagine the ability to brighten instruments on the sides of your mix while keeping vocals pristine and untouched. The S&M Width knob further enables you to adjust the overall stereo field, providing an extra layer of creative control.

The console is equipped with three front-panel switchable insert points, making it effortless to integrate external analog processors into your mastering chain. This feature, combined with stepped controls, means you can easily recall settings with precision, ensuring consistent results every time. Additionally, the MASTER seamlessly connects with the Dangerous Liaison for expanded routing options, making it a versatile centerpiece for any mastering setup.

Key Features:

  • Audiophile-grade components for crystal-clear sound
  • S&M button for integrated Mid-Side processing
  • S&M Width knob to adjust stereo field width
  • Three front-panel switchable insert points for external processing
  • Stepped controls for easy recall and repeatability
  • Two stereo inputs and three stereo outputs (one dedicated to monitoring)
  • Seamless integration with the Dangerous Liaison for expanded routing options

Product specs

Type Analog
Channels 2
Inputs - Line 4 x XLR
Outputs - Main 2 x XLR (Main 1), 2 x XLR (Main 2), 2 x XLR (Monitor)
Send/Return I/O 6 x XLR (Send), 6 x XLR (Return)
Rackmountable Yes
Height 10"
Width 17"
Depth 22"
Weight 28 lbs.
